Java中的数组声明

时间:2011-03-03 20:18:11

标签: java arrays

  

可能重复:
  Difference between int[] array and int array[]

int[] arr;在功能上与int arr[];相同吗?

5 个答案:

答案 0 :(得分:5)

是。在声明数组时,您可以将大括号放在任何一个位置。

奖金:你甚至可以把它们放在这里: int []arr

答案 1 :(得分:1)

是的,功能是一样的。你可以在任何地方拥有大括号。

int[] a,b,c[];

相当于

int a[],b[],c[][];

答案 2 :(得分:1)

这只是风格问题。你可以选择你喜欢的风格。他们表现完全一样。有人声称如果你写“int [] array”,它会更清楚它是一个整数数组而不是写“int array []”。

答案 3 :(得分:0)

只是安抚C ++开发人员,他们包括int arr []。 (或者至少我在学校讲过的)

答案 4 :(得分:0)

是的,它是一样的。 int [] arr虽然更方便。